Our Global Presence
Canada
57 Sherway St,
Stoney Creek, ON
L8J 0J3
India
606, Suvas Scala,
S P Ring Road, Nikol,
Ahmedabad 380049
USA
1131 Baycrest Drive,
Wesley Chapel,
FL 33544
Overview of the Topic: In the bustling world of IT, melding Angular with .NET forms a formidable shield for applications against cyber threats. Here, we’ll explore how integrating these platforms enhances app development and security. With rising digital data breaches, safeguarding applications isn’t just a feature; it’s a necessity. This is especially true for Angular applications which are often targeted due to their widespread use. By the end, you’ll grasp how Angular and .NET join forces to fortify apps against cyber threats. You’ll walk away with actionable strategies to lock down your applications.
Angular is renowned for its scalability and powerful framework, making it a preferred choice for front-end development due to its ease in creating dynamic web applications. For instance, a company developing a user-friendly dashboard for their customers might choose Angular to ensure the interface is responsive and interactive. On the other hand, the .NET framework is a robust platform ideal for backend development, offering extensive libraries and runtime environments for server-side logic and database operations. This means that the same company can rely on .NET to manage their server-side processes, like handling user data and transactions securely.
Integrating Angular with .NET through APIs creates a seamless synergy, enabling Angular to manage the UI while .NET handles backend processes, resulting in a robust and efficient infrastructure. Imagine an online retail store where Angular powers the product display and user interactions, while .NET manages the inventory, payment processing, and order fulfilment behind the scenes. This integration ensures that the application is both user-friendly and capable of handling complex backend operations, providing a smooth and reliable experience for both developers and end-users.
Ensuring secure user access is paramount in Angular applications. By implementing OAuth for authentication and configuring route security, you can ensure that only authorized users access sensitive data and functionalities.
Staying proactive in vulnerability management is crucial for maintaining application security. Regularly updating Angular’s dependencies and leveraging tools like Retire.js to identify and address outdated libraries can significantly reduce the risk of vulnerabilities that could compromise your application’s integrity and data security.
.NET’s built-in Identity framework is invaluable for managing users’ access, offering customization and scalability to fit most enterprise environments. Data protection is fundamental, and .NET facilitates encryption of data both at rest and in transit, providing robust defence against breaches. Additionally, using .NET middleware enhances security by performing multiple tasks such as logging, authentication, and error handling, adding an extra layer of protection.
Incorporating HTTPS and secure tokens is essential for ensuring the security of your applications. Using HTTPS secures the communication channel, preventing eavesdropping and man-in-the-middle attacks. For example, when you visit your bank’s website, HTTPS ensures that your data, such as login credentials and account information, remains encrypted and secure. Similarly, tokens like JWT (JSON Web Tokens) provide secure mechanisms for user authentication across services. Imagine a single sign-on system where you log in once and gain access to multiple applications securely; JWTs make this possible by verifying your identity without repeatedly exposing your credentials.
Threat detection and response are critical components of a robust security strategy. .NET offers tools like Microsoft Identity’s Conditional Access, which provides real-time threat analytics and response capabilities. For instance, if unusual login activity is detected, such as an attempt from a different country, Conditional Access can automatically prompt additional verification steps or block access altogether. This proactive approach helps protect your applications from malicious activities, ensuring that potential security risks are mitigated before they can cause harm.
Adopting secure coding practices is fundamental in building resilient applications. Writing code with security in mind from the outset can prevent vulnerabilities from being introduced. For example, a developer working on a new e-commerce platform might use .NET’s Code Analysis toolkit to identify and fix security issues during the development phase. This tool can highlight potential vulnerabilities like SQL injection or cross-site scripting, allowing the developer to address them early on. By incorporating these best practices, developers can ensure that their codebase remains secure and reliable, ultimately protecting the end-user’s data and maintaining their trust.
Regular penetration testing is crucial for .NET/Angular applications. It involves simulating real-world attacks to identify and address potential vulnerabilities proactively, ensuring robust security measures are in place.
Conducting periodic security audits is essential to ensure your .NET/Angular applications comply with security policies and procedures. These audits help identify and rectify security gaps, ensuring continuous protection against evolving threats.
Keep Angular and .NET frameworks updated. Regular patches are released to fix vulnerabilities and offer new features.
Integrating Angular with .NET can transform the security landscape of your applications by combining client-side operations with advanced server-side techniques for a comprehensive approach to securing apps. As cybersecurity evolves, the partnership between Angular and .NET is poised to adapt, continually offering cutting-edge protections. Consider how you can implement these strategic insights in your current Angular and .NET projects to fortify your applications. Start today, and build a safer digital tomorrow.
Contact us for more information & to learn how we can help you build apps using different technologies, or to develop Web Application using Angular, visit our Hire Angular Developer page. At HK Infosoft, we are destined to provide you with an innovative solution using the latest technology stacks. E-mail us any clock at – hello@hkinfosoft.com or Skype us: “hkinfosoft”.
Content Source:
57 Sherway St,
Stoney Creek, ON
L8J 0J3
606, Suvas Scala,
S P Ring Road, Nikol,
Ahmedabad 380049
1131 Baycrest Drive,
Wesley Chapel,
FL 33544
57 Sherway St,
Stoney Creek, ON
L8J 0J3
606, Suvas Scala,
S P Ring Road, Nikol,
Ahmedabad 380049
1131 Baycrest Drive,
Wesley Chapel,
FL 33544
© 2024 — HK Infosoft. All Rights Reserved.
© 2024 — HK Infosoft. All Rights Reserved.
T&C | Privacy Policy | Sitemap